Transaction 541562256745dfaec0404dbebea8e519e88b82cc23c738d4b0af7dc78b72be82
1 Input
2 Outputs
- 541562256745dfaec0404dbebea8e519e88b82cc23c738d4b0af7dc78b72be82:0
- 541562256745dfaec0404dbebea8e519e88b82cc23c738d4b0af7dc78b72be82:1
value 90000
address 3E23pFRoR9M4YZM4vTXuBbt6DRoWYvQjK7
value 204811870
address 3HFuP6r5JAeaSsMSQrtFoKHzPTT9cEAc3e